Chesapeake Foundation Waterproofing

Foundation waterproofing is the process of treating a surface to prevent water from passing through it under hydrostatic pressure. It protects against water gathering if the drainage at the bottom of the foundation walls isn't working correctly. Signs You Need Foundation Waterproofing:

  • Visible efflorescence on interior walls.
  • Bowed wall are visible.
  • Cracks appear on your basement walls.
  • Water on your basement floors.
  • Basement water leaks are visible.

Is it better to waterproof the basement from inside or outside?

The best approach to protect your basement is to waterproof the outside of your foundation. Interior waterproofing can help avoid more water damage, but having the repairs done on the outside addresses the flaws at their source.

Does Inside waterproofing work?

Interior waterproofing can only be used to eliminate water that has already gathered in your basement; it cannot be used to prevent water from entering in the first place.

How much does it cost to waterproof a basement from the outside?

The average cost of waterproofing your basement with a coating or membrane from the outside is $3 to $6 per square foot, which includes supplies and labor. Water cannot penetrate the basement walls because of the liquid or sheet membrane.

How long does exterior waterproofing last?

Everyone who has visited a new construction site knows that there is rubbish, construction waste, and uncompacted soil used for backfill. All of these factors combine to create an outside waterproofing system that lasts no longer than 7-10 years.

How does exterior waterproofing work?

Exterior Waterproofing is a system that has multiple benefits for your foundation: it prevents water from coming into contact with the bare foundation walls, it directs water to the weeping tile installed beside the footing, and it prevents hydrostatic pressure from building up against the footing when installed properly.

Is waterproofing a basement worth it?

The reinforcing of your home's foundation is the number one reason why basement waterproofing is worth it for practically every homeowner. While some basement waterproofing methods use membranes to directly reinforce the foundation, any waterproofing system will help protect it from moisture.

How long does exterior basement waterproofing last?

The amount of waterproofing product used, the environment, and the degree of the initial damage all play a role in how long waterproofing lasts. There is no specific date because of all the diverse constituents, but most professionals will guarantee it for 10 years or more.

How often do you have to waterproof the basement?

The ebb and flow of groundwater wears down external waterproofing materials over the period of 3 to 5 years. A basement's outside waterproofing can endure longer depending on the kind of soil, location, and landscape slope (grade).

Do foundations need waterproofing?

The great majority of foundation issues are caused by water. Wet soil beneath a foundation can expand and weaken. Waterproofing and vapor barriers are available to safeguard your foundation. That's not even the most important reason to keep your makeup dry.

When should you waterproof your foundation?

A waterproof coating is frequently put to the foundation of a home to keep soil moisture out. This method does not prevent water from entering the basement during construction through gaps, cracks, and holes. Basement waterproofing should keep both water and moisture out.

Does homeowners insurance cover foundation repair?

In general, your home's foundations are covered by insurance if they're destroyed by an insured event such as a flood, fire, or storm. Keep in mind that natural foundation shifting and settling, as well as damage caused by tree roots, are almost always excluded from coverage.

When should you walk away from foundation issues?

Uneven/Drooping Floors: If you've discovered that your home's floors are uneven or sagging, you may have a foundation problem. - Crooked Doors: As the foundation lowers, splits, or changes, you may notice uneven doors.

How do you know if a foundation crack is serious?

You're looking for cracks or signs of damage in the basement or crawlspace beneath your property. You've entered perilous territory if you notice long horizontal fissures, tilting, or bowing walls. The fissures may resemble stair-steps if the foundation walls are composed of concrete block.

  • Is foundation waterproofing necessary?

    Putting a barrier between a below-grade building and the moisture in the surrounding soil and filling. When the foundation is below the water table or in a flood zone, waterproofing is extremely critical.

  • What should I use to seal my foundation?

    Do use a masonry waterproofing solution on bare inside basement walls. If your foil test revealed that water is penetrating through your basement walls and leaving them damp, cover the interior of the walls with high-quality waterproof paint.

  • Should I seal my concrete foundation?

    The crack should be sealed regardless of what created it, or whether it is moving or static. Correctly sealing the fracture will protect the wall's structure while also preventing water from accessing the area within.

  • What can I mix with cement to make it waterproof?

    For the masonry of external walls using hard brick, 1 part cement, 3.5 parts sand, and 0.25 part lime is commonly used. For the same work, but with considerably softer limestone, an entirely different mixing ratio is recommended: 1 part cement, 9 parts sand, and 2 parts lime.

  • How do you waterproof an outside block wall?

    Apply a thick coat of masonry waterproofing paint to the cinder block wall, pressing it into the cracks and crevices of the block. It is recommended to use a masonry-specific paint roller or brush. Allow to dry overnight or at least 12 hours between coats.

Crawl Space Vapor Barrier Installation

Crawl space vapor barrier installation is a cost-effective way to solve moisture control problems. Crawl space vapor barriers are designed to keep humidity, water, and wet air from entering the home through the crawl space floor. This helps prevent mold and mildew build-up that can lead to structural damage and uncomfortable living conditions for the occupants of your home!
